## Limits & Quotas: Digest Scheduling

Quick reference for reviewers poking at Plumeletter's digest scheduler. Each tenant gets a bounded number of digest sends per window, and oversized digests get split rather than dropped. Going over quota parks the batch until the next window — no silent discards, ever. If you're changing anything here, check the fairness tests first. The current quota values and window sizes are these.

tuning constants:
QUOTAS = {
    "druwyn": 5,
    "holix": 5,
    "zorath": 5,
    "holwyn": 10,
}

The appointment reminder job at Larkvale Clinic runs every morning at 06:00 and pushes SMS batches through the Nimbex gateway. Review the retry logic in reminder_worker.py carefully — duplicate sends have bitten us before. The worker authenticates against our internal scheduling service before each batch. Use the key below for the staging environment only.

gateway credential: kto3_qfe

## Session Handling for Health Checks

The Corvel gateway sits behind the Lanternside load balancer, which probes /healthz every ten seconds. Health-check requests are stateless by design: they bypass the session store entirely so that probe traffic never inflates session counts or evicts real user sessions. New team members should note that the deep-check endpoint, /healthz/deep, does verify session-store connectivity and therefore requires authentication. When probing it manually, supply the token below.

bearer token for tajep-kajef: eyJhbGciOiJIUzI1NiIsInR5cCI6IkpXVCJ9.eyJzdWIiOiIoOsZ23In0.CsygO0hs

**Ticket: Config drift in carved-out user module**

While extracting the user module from the Brindlewick monolith, we found the standalone service's session settings no longer match the monolith's hardened baseline. Token lifetimes and lockout thresholds diverged across three deploys. Please review each delta for security impact. The current effective values on the new service are as follows.

settings of fafog-haduf:
ZORIX_PIN=4648
ZORIX_METRICS_HOST=metrics.zorix.paliqsys.corp
ZORIX_LOG_LEVEL=info
ZORIX_TENANT=druix